I have a set of physical machines with VMware running on it. The install paths of virtual machines on those physical machines are the same and I also know the UUID of the physical machine from SMBIOS.
As per the VMware documentation site, "The UUID is based on the physical computer's identifier and the path to the virtual machine's configuration file. This UUID is generated when you power on or reset the virtual machine. As long as you do not move or copy the virtual machine to another location, the UUID remains constant."
Can you please let me know, how exactly is the UUID for the virtual machine is generated? This would help me to map of virtual machines and physical machines.
